A triple structure engineering strategy, combining amorphization, two-dimensional morphology design and Fe doping, is developed to promote the OER activity of metal phosphates, simultaneously enhancing the catalytic active sites and intrinsic activity.

AbstractThe successful photo-catalyst library gives significant information on feature that affects photo-catalytic performance and proposes new materials. Competency is considerably significant to form multi-functional photo-catalysts with flexible characteristics. Since recently, two-dimensional materials (2DMs) gained much attention from researchers, due to their unique thickness-dependent uses, mainly for photo-catalytic, outstanding chemical and physical properties. Photo-catalytic water splitting and hydrogen (H2) evolution by plentiful compounds as electron (e−) donors is estimated to participate in constructing clean method for solar H2-formation. Heterogeneous photo-catalysis received much research attention caused by their applications to tackle numerous energy and environmental issues. This broad review explains progress regarding 2DMs, significance in structure, and catalytic results. We will discuss in detail current progresses of approaches for adjusting 2DMs-based photo-catalysts to assess their photo-activity including doping, hetero-structure scheme, and functional formation assembly. Suggested plans, e.g., doping and sensitization of semiconducting 2DMs, increasing electrical conductance, improving catalytic active sites, strengthening interface coupling in semiconductors (SCs) 2DMs, forming nano-structures, building multi-junction nano-composites, increasing photo-stability of SCs, and using combined results of adapted approaches, are summed up. Hence, to further improve 2DMs photo-catalyst properties, hetero-structure design-based 2DMs’ photo-catalyst basic mechanism is also reviewed.

AbstractNanozyme is a collection of nanomaterials with enzyme-like activity but exhibits higher environmental tolerance and long-term stability than their natural counterparts. Improving the catalytic activity and expanding the category of nanozymes are prerequisites to complement or even supersede natural enzymes. Specifically, a powerful hydrolytic nanozyme is demanded to degrade the unsustainable substance which natural enzymes hardly achieve. However, the development of hydrolytic nanozymes is still hindered by diverse hydrolytic substrates and following complicated mechanisms. Here, we apply two strategies which are informed by data to screen and predict catalytic active sites of MOF (metal–organic framework) based hydrolytic nanozymes. One is to increase the intrinsic activity by finely tuned Lewis acidity of the metal clusters. The other is to adjust the volume density of the active sites by shortening the length of ligands. Finally, we construct a Ce-FMA-MOF-based hydrolytic nanozyme with robust cleavage ability towards phosphate bonds, amide bonds, glycosidic bonds whose energy ascend in order; and even their mixture, biofilms. This work provides a rational methodology to design hydrolytic nanozyme, enriches the diversity of nanozymes, and potentially sheds a light on the evolution of enzyme engineering in the future.
